Home & Garden Design, Atlanta - Danna Cain, ASLA
This photo was taken late summer when the drought tolerant rudbeckia black eyed susans are in full bloom. See also nanho blue butterfly bush and russian sage combined with annuals. Note the stepping stone steps that provide access from the driveway to the middle terrace then all the way up the hill to a bench that overlooks this lush butterfly garden. From there, the paths meander thru the woods and provide hours of nature play and exploration. A very interesting pollinator garden that supports wildlife.
